Transaction 3029534161a6dd318db0458770322d69f56a4390cfb74bf7aab70844ca88fe81
1 Input
1 Output
-
3029534161a6dd318db0458770322d69f56a4390cfb74bf7aab70844ca88fe81:0
- value
- 5415830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 035c91bd5a430cbb6710a6d0207c5ee8ebf9fe2e OP_EQUAL
- address
- M8Cw9qGmhqtRQjR6b8h5ZRgS1mE4V3jGnK